Child rapist gets 12 years and 5 months prison sentence

By Vijay Narayan
28/03/2025

A man who raped the 5 year old daughter of his friend's sister, has been sentenced to 12 years and 5 months of imprisonment, with a non-parole period of 9 years and 5 months.

High Court Judge, Justice Rajasinghe found the man guilty of one count of rape for the incident on 12th September last year.

He says rape carries a maximum sentence of life imprisonment.

Justice Rajasinghe says this case involves the sexual exploitation of a young child by someone familiar within her home environment.

He says sexual exploitation of children in their domestic settings has become a significant social issue.

The judge says the troubling phenomenon of abusing children for sexual gratification requires prompt and effective attention.

The maximum penalty for rape is life imprisonment and the tariff for the rape of a child is between 11 and 20 years imprisonment.

The judge also highlighted that the Prosecution did not provide a Victim Impact Report, leaving the Court without evidence of how this crime has affected the young complainant.

He told the perpetrator that he committed this crime while the girl was playing with her younger sibling, away from the adults.

The judge selected 12 years as the starting point of the sentence and increased the sentence by two years due to the aggravating factors, resulting in a total of fourteen years.

Considering his prior character, the judge reduced the sentence by one year, and set the final sentence at 13 years of imprisonment.
